Challenger 45 Row Crop: Common Issues and Maintenance Tips
#1
The Challenger 45 Row Crop tractor is widely used in agriculture and field operations. Its excellent performance and durability have made it a favorite among farmers and machinery operators. However, like any complex piece of equipment, the Challenger 45 may experience some issues, especially as it ages. On Panswork, many users have shared their experiences, problems, and solutions regarding this machine. Below is a summary of common issues and maintenance tips.
Common Issues with the Challenger 45
  1. Power Output Problems
    Many users report that the Challenger 45 struggles with power output, particularly when working under heavy loads. This can be noticed when towing heavier farming equipment, causing the tractor to become sluggish or underpowered.
  2. Hydraulic System Failures
    Hydraulic system failures are another frequent problem. Some users have noticed hydraulic oil leaks or low pressure in the hydraulic system, which directly affects the tractor's traction and operational efficiency. Any hydraulic failure can result in the tractor not performing as expected.
  3. Electrical System Issues
    A few users have mentioned issues with the electrical system, especially with the starting battery not providing enough power. Loose electrical connections or a worn-out battery can lead to difficulty starting or electrical system failures.
  4. Engine Overheating
    There have been reports of engine overheating after extended use, leading to the tractor shutting down. Overheating may be caused by a blocked cooling system, insufficient coolant, or a faulty cooling fan.
  5. Transmission Problems
    Some owners have experienced problems with the transmission, such as difficulty shifting gears or unusual noises. Transmission failures can significantly impact the tractor’s efficiency and safety.
Diagnosing and Solving Common Problems
  1. Solving Power Output Issues
    Start by checking the fuel system for issues, such as a clogged fuel filter or malfunctioning fuel injectors. If the fuel supply is fine, inspect the air filtration system for blockages, ensuring proper airflow to the engine. Also, check the exhaust system for any obstructions that may be causing inadequate power output.
  2. Addressing Hydraulic System Failures
    Hydraulic system leaks are often caused by worn or damaged seals. Inspect the hydraulic hoses, connections, and valves to ensure there are no leaks. If leaks are detected, replace the seals or repair the relevant parts. Also, check the hydraulic fluid levels and quality to ensure the system is properly lubricated and clean.
  3. Fixing Electrical System Problems
    For electrical issues, first check the battery voltage to ensure it’s sufficient. If the battery is low, consider replacing it or checking the charging system to ensure it is functioning properly. Also, inspect all electrical connections for corrosion or looseness.
  4. Preventing Engine Overheating
    Check the coolant level and ensure there are no leaks. If the coolant is sufficient, inspect the radiator and cooling fan for proper operation. If the radiator is clogged with dirt or debris, clean it to improve cooling efficiency. If the cooling fan is malfunctioning, it may need to be replaced.
  5. Fixing Transmission Problems
    For transmission issues, check the transmission fluid level and condition. Low or poor-quality fluid can cause shifting problems or unusual noises. If the fluid is fine, the transmission components such as gears or synchronizers may be worn and may require replacement.
Maintenance Tips for the Challenger 45
  1. Regular Inspections and Servicing
    Routine inspections and servicing are crucial, especially in heavy-duty working conditions. Regularly check the hydraulic system, electrical system, engine, and transmission to ensure all components are in optimal working condition.
  2. Changing Filters and Fluids
    Regularly replace the air filter, oil filter, and hydraulic filter to keep systems running smoothly. Also, change the engine oil, hydraulic fluid, and transmission fluid as per the recommended service intervals to ensure proper lubrication and system health.
  3. Cleaning the Cooling System
    The radiator should be cleaned periodically, especially in dusty environments. A clogged radiator will cause the engine to overheat and reduce its efficiency. Ensure that the cooling system is free from dirt, debris, or blockages.
  4. Battery Maintenance
    Check the battery’s voltage and the connections regularly. Clean the battery terminals to prevent corrosion. If the battery is old or not holding a charge, it may need to be replaced.
Conclusion
While the Challenger 45 Row Crop is a durable and efficient piece of agricultural machinery, it may encounter common issues like power output problems, hydraulic system failures, electrical issues, engine overheating, and transmission failures. Regular maintenance and timely repairs are essential to keep the machine running smoothly and efficiently. By following the proper diagnostic steps and addressing issues as they arise, operators can ensure the Challenger 45 continues to perform at its best for years to come.
